As AI tools like GitHub Copilot improve efficiency, the article raises concerns about the potential diminishing of experiential learning among junior developers. The author argues that these early experiences are crucial for building future engineering leaders. Relying solely on AI to execute tasks may lead to a lack of foundational skills, which could result in a fragile organizational structure lacking deep system understanding. The need to find a balance between AI assistance and experiential learning is emphasized.
The increasing reliance on AI for coding tasks raises questions about the traditional pathways for junior developers to grow into senior roles.
